House Republicans on Sunday shared a video clip on Twitter from a press conference last month in which US President Joe Biden said that the Taliban takeover of Afghanistan was not "inevitable" as Afghanistan has "300,000 well-equipped" troops. He also said there would be no circumstance that people would be lifted off the roof of the US Embassy in Afghanistan.
At least five people were killed at Kabul airport as hundreds of people tried to forcibly enter planes leaving the Afghan capital, witnesses told Reuters. One witness said he had seen the bodies of five people being taken to a vehicle. Another witness said it was not clear whether the victims were killed by gunshots or in a stampede.
A video has surfaced online showing hundreds of people jostling to board a plane at the Kabul airport to fly out of Afghanistan. This comes after Taliban took control of the country. Earlier, US troops fired gunshots at the airport as thousands of people crowded the tarmac. Afghan President Ashraf Ghani fled the country on Sunday.
Former Afghanistan President Ashraf Ghani who fled Kabul on Sunday as the Taliban took control is currently in Oman, reports said on Monday. Ghani's plane was not allowed to land in Tajikistan's Dushanbe where he had earlier fled to and he is likely to leave for the US soon, reports added. Former Afghan NSA Hamdullah Mohib is also with Ghani.
